§ 141. Acquisition or establishment of self-supporting improvements.\nThe town board of any town in Suffolk county and of any suburban town\nmay, by ordinance, provide for the acquisition, construction, lease or\npurchase of any self-supporting improvement, or may establish any\nexisting dock, pier, wharf, bathing beach or recreational facility, and\nparking areas in connection therewith as a self-supporting improvement,\npursuant to the provisions of this article.\n
